Gardena-based EntComm , a developer of software-as-a-service products, has sold its product division to a Indian software firm, TAKE Solutions. TAKE is also buying EntComm's offshore operations, which will merge with Take Solutions' center in Chennai. Tags: entcomm saas software merger acquisition take supply chain.
